题目中要求创建一个视图actor_name_view,其中包含两列,分别为first_name和last_name。还要对这两列重新命名,将第一列的名称修改为first_name_v,将第二列的名称修改为last_name_v。
时间: 2024-03-10 22:45:47 浏览: 19
好的,你的问题是如何在SQL中创建一个视图actor_name_view,并将其中的两列重新命名?
可以使用以下SQL语句来创建一个视图actor_name_view,并将其中的两列重新命名:
```
CREATE VIEW actor_name_view AS
SELECT first_name AS first_name_v, last_name AS last_name_v
FROM actor;
```
这将创建一个名为actor_name_view的视图,其包含两列,分别为first_name_v和last_name_v,这两列分别对应actor表中的first_name和last_name列。使用AS关键字可以将原始列名(first_name和last_name)重命名为新列名(first_name_v和last_name_v)。
相关问题
针对actor表创建视图name,you只包含first类以及last name两列,并对这两列重新命名
好的,你的问题是如何在SQL中创建一个视图name,并只包含actor表中的first_name和last_name两列,并将这两列重命名?
可以使用以下SQL语句来创建一个视图name,并只包含actor表中的first_name和last_name两列,并将这两列重命名:
```
CREATE VIEW name AS
SELECT first_name AS first, last_name AS last
FROM actor;
```
这将创建一个名为name的视图,其只包含actor表中的first_name和last_name两列,并将这两列重命名为first和last。使用AS关键字可以将原始列名(first_name和last_name)重命名为新列名(first和last)。
String sql = "update actor set actor_name=? where id=?";
This is a SQL statement that updates the name of an actor in a database table called "actor". The statement uses two placeholders indicated by the question marks:
1. The first placeholder is for the new name of the actor and will be replaced with a value when the statement is executed.
2. The second placeholder is for the ID of the actor whose name will be updated and will also be replaced with a value when the statement is executed.
The statement is dynamic because it can be used to update any actor's name by passing in the appropriate values for the placeholders.